Common Indicators of Roof Covering Issues



Have you ever before observed dark spots on your ceiling or missing out on shingles on your roofing? These can be indicators of roofing issues that shouldn't be disregarded.




If your roofing system's got leaks, you could see water stains or bubbling paint on your ceilings. This shows moisture getting in, which can result in mold growth and more damages.

One more indicator to watch for is granule loss on your roof shingles. When you see excessive granules in your rain gutters, your tiles may be nearing the end of their life expectancy. It's a caution that they're losing their safety finish.

If you identify any kind of sagging locations on your roofing system, that's a red flag. A sagging roof can indicate architectural concerns that can lead to a collapse if not resolved.

Do not ignore the outside. Fractured or curling tiles and corrosion on steel roofs are also signs that your roof isn't in top shape.

Preventative Steps for Your Roofing



Frequently checking your roofing system can help you catch possible problems prior to they escalate. Make it a habit to inspect your roofing at least twice a year, ideally in springtime and fall. Try to find damaged tiles, debris, or any kind of indicators of wear. If you spot anything worrying, resolve it quickly to avoid further concerns.

Keep your gutters clean and free of debris. Clogged seamless gutters can lead to water back-up, triggering leakages and damages to your roofing. If you're not comfortable climbing up a ladder, think about hiring an expert for this job.

Make sure appropriate ventilation in your attic. Excellent airflow assists manage temperature and moisture, stopping mold and mildew growth and expanding the life of your roof covering.

Ultimately, purchase a roofing maintenance strategy if you're unclear about the maintenance. Regular upkeep can catch small concerns prior to they become costly repair work.

When to Call a Specialist



Recognizing when to call an expert for roofing problems can save you time and money, specifically if you notice signs of serious damages. If you see missing roof shingles, water spots on your ceilings, or substantial leakages, it's time to connect to a specialist. These problems can indicate that your roof covering requires immediate focus to stop more damage to your home.

Don't wait until the issue intensifies. If you can not safely gain access to your roofing system or if you're not sure about the degree of the damage, it's best to call a professional. They've the experience and tools needed to evaluate the circumstance accurately.

Also, consider employing a roof specialist after an extreme storm. High winds, hail storm, or hefty snowfall can trigger concealed damage that mightn't be visible from the ground. A professional inspection can uncover these problems before they end up being costly fixings.
